如何查python的工作目录

如何查python的工作目录

作者:Rhett Bai发布时间:2026-01-07阅读时长:0 分钟阅读次数:31

用户关注问题

Q
如何查看当前Python脚本的运行路径?

在运行Python脚本时,如何确认脚本当前的工作目录位置?

A

使用os模块查看当前工作目录

可以导入os模块,使用os.getcwd()函数获取当前工作目录的绝对路径。示例代码:

import os
print(os.getcwd())
Q
Python项目中工作目录如何影响文件操作?

Python的工作目录和文件读取有什么关系?为什么很多文件读取路径需要注意工作目录?

A

工作目录决定相对路径的起点

Python文件操作时使用相对路径,默认是相对于当前工作目录。如果工作目录不正确,读取文件可能会失败。因此,应明确工作目录或使用绝对路径避免路径问题。

Q
如何在Python中更改当前的工作目录?

有没有方法在Python脚本里动态更改工作目录?这在什么情况下会有用?

A

使用os.chdir()改变工作目录

可以调用os.chdir(path)函数更改当前工作目录,path为目标目录路径。这在脚本需要访问不同路径下文件时非常有用,确保文件操作指向正确的路径。